Magic Jack Go
The new magic jack go works well easy to use. The value should be very good time will tell. I had internet phone service before this sound quality seems to be as good. Only problem I had was unable to set it up over web site I didn't understand what I was doing wrong so I called customer services big mistake. Very difficult to understand person on the other side. A lot of wasted time on hold a lot, this should of been a simple process that took an hour an a half. And if you keep your same phone number it took another 6 to 8 days for the turn around for this an another $20.00 in cost. And for the 911 service if you wish to keep it a cost of around $10.00 a year. That was o.k. but I didn't know this up front, I don't remember reading about these fees before I bought it. But it has worked well so fare. One thing I haven't tried yet is sending a fax over it so it will be interesting to see if it works?Read full review

Economical Phone Service
I do not spend much time on the phone however I do need an active voice line at home. This solved the problem at minimal cost. I do spend a lot of time on the internet so I already have reliable internet service. I paired this device along with a pair of Uniden wireless phones and a used Samsung Galaxy S3 cell phone that uses the FreedomPop 'Free' cell phone service. The S3 has MagicJack Voip and Text application loaded on it. The S3 is also set up to use my home WiFi network so that I have minimal data usage on the FreedomPop network. That gives home phone and cell service with unlimited voice and texts on the same phone number for $35/year --- just can not beat the cost savings.
I have been told by several people that the audio quality is excellent (note: one person did note that audio sometimes broke up). For my part I can not detect any difference in the audio quality from any other service.Read full review

Marginal at best- can no longer use my own answering machine system.
I've had repeated problems with the performance since I installed it several weeks ago.
Specifically, I cannot use my own answering machine system anymore. My landline is now automatically defaulted to Magic Jacks' answering service, which I don't like. I tried hooking up my answering machine directly to the MJ device via a split telephone jack, but my answering machine now only works on occasion for some weird reason.
Also, there have been many times that my landline doesn't work anymore - period. No dial tone. And when you call the landline from another phone, your call gets sent right to MJ's voice mail service- the landline doesn't even ring when the call is coming in.
Sure, it's more than 20 times cheaper than paying for phone service through my cable company, but what good is it if it hardly ever works correctly?Read full review
